Kenilworth - Wikipedia Kenilworth ( ˈ k ɛ n ɪ l w ər θ KEN-il-wərth) is a market town and civil parish in the Warwick District of Warwickshire, England, 5 5 miles (9 km) southwest of Coventry and 4 5 miles (7 km) north of both Warwick and Leamington Spa

Kenilworth Castle - Wikipedia Kenilworth Castle is a castle in the town of Kenilworth in Warwickshire, England, managed by English Heritage; much of it is in ruins The castle was founded after the Norman Conquest of 1066; with development through to the Tudor period
Kenilworth, New Jersey - Wikipedia Kenilworth is a borough in Union County, in the U S state of New Jersey As of the 2020 United States census, the borough's population was 8,427, [8] [9] an increase of 513 (+6 5%) from the 2010 census count of 7,914, [18] [19] which in turn reflected an increase of 239 (+3 1%) from the 7,675 counted in the 2000 census [20]
